Transaction 704166fbc14a4c96b7ce0ad1927eefba016f01e214ad81bc2cf17a0a02b65626
1 Input
1 Output
-
704166fbc14a4c96b7ce0ad1927eefba016f01e214ad81bc2cf17a0a02b65626:0
- value
- 1311854
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ae7ae6b2affe44d716fc6cf0c5674fb19759fc4a OP_EQUAL
- address
- 3HbajF9rsYZ7jmiW3R6wDbpLGG8biSMsMV